Le Mans vs Lyngvig Fyr Climate & Distance Between

Denmark flag
  • The distance between Le Mans, France and Lyngvig Fyr, Denmark is approximately 1,051 km or 653 mi.
  • To reach Le Mans in this distance one would set out from Lyngvig Fyr bearing 214.1° or SW and follow the great circles arc to approach Le Mans bearing 207.9° or SSW .
  • Both have a marine west coast climate (Cfb).
  • Both are in or near the cool temperate moist forest biome.
  • The mean annual temperature is 3 °C (5.3°F) warmer.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 1.5 °C (2.7°F) less in Le Mans. The continentality subtype is truly oceanic for both.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 18 mm (0.7 in) less which is equivalent to 18 l/m² (0.44 US gal/ft²) or 180,000 l/ha (19,243 US gal/ac) less. About 1 as much.
  • There are 326 more hours of sunlight per year in Le Mans. In whichever way circa 0h 53' more per day or about 1 1/5 as many.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 8.1° higher in Le Mans than in Lyngvig Fyr.
